Abstract
The INMM’s 53rd Annual Meeting, heldin Orlando, Florida USA, was a remarkableexperience that demonstrated howinterconnected we all are in the world ofnuclear materials management. Settingthe stage, the opening session featuredpresentations with extraordinary detail ofthe Fukushima nuclear accident and thesubsequent cleanup and recovery activities.1 Attendees also heard firsthand, in thediscussion of lessons learned, the impactthis event has had on almost every technicalarea of expertise that defines theINMM. The Fukushima accident was thesubject of this column a year ago, whenit was speculated that the event may representa strategic inflection point for theemerging nuclear renaissance at the time.2Although a year later it is still too early toassign that level of impact, all of the indicatorspoint to long-lasting disruptions tothe renaissance on a global scale.
